Christmas Mule


5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

Description

A fun take on a Moscow mule using healthy, local ingredients like Kickin’ Kombucha! 


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 2 cups of Champagne
  • 1 cup of Ginger Beer
  • 7 ounces of Hibiscus Kombucha
  • 2 ounces of Vodka
  • Lime spritz (optional)
Instacart Get Recipe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Pour in your champagne and wait for the bubbles to settle
  2. Add in your ginger beer
  3. Add in your kombucha
  4. Add in your Vodka
  5. Stir until all of the liquids are incorporated and are a uniform color.
  6. Pour the Christmas Mule into your choice of glasses (you can drink them in anything you\’d drink champagne out of!)
  7. Top with a little more champagne and a spritz of lime if you feel so inclined.
  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Category: Cocktails
  • Cuisine: Bevrage

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 cup
  • Calories: 91
  • Sugar: 6.5 g
  • Sodium: 17.3 mg
  • Fat: 0 g
  • Carbohydrates: 10.8 g
  • Fiber: 0.2 g
  • Protein: 0.3 g
  • Cholesterol: 0 mg
